4-3 Date and Time Setting
The time/date generator and timer recording will not function if the time and date are not set.
Set the month/day/year, hour/minute and Summer Time Compensation ON/OFF on the CLOCK SET screen. The setting can
be checked even on the display.

Operation
Turn on the monitor and VCR.
Press the [MENU] button to display the main menu screen.
Press the [SHIFT 7] button to set the cursor on <CLOCK
SET> on the main menu.
Press the [SET +/
–] button.
[The <CLOCK SET> screen is shown. The cursor shows
the <TIME> setting item and the hour digit blinks.
* Check that <SUMMER TIME> on the last line is set to
“OFF.
Set the “hour” by pressing the [SET +/
–] button. This VCR
uses the 24-hour system.
• Press the [SET +] button to increase the numerical value
and the [SET –] button to decrease it (same for minute,
month, day and year setting).
5
During summer time period, set the time with a one-hour
delay.
5
During standard time period, set the actual time.
Press the [SHIFT t] button so that the minutes digit blinks.
Press the [SET +/
–] button to set the minutes.
Press the [SHIFT 7] button.
[The <DATE> setting item is shown by the cursor and the
month item blinks.
5
Press the [SET +/
–] button to set the month.
Press the [SHIFT t] button so that the day item blinks and
set the day with the [SET +/
–] button.
In the same way, press the [SHIFT t] button so that the year
item blinks and set the year with the [SET +/–] button.
For summer time compensation
• Press the [SHIFT 7] button to set the cursor to <SUMMER
TIME> and press the [SET +/
–] button to set <SUMMER
TIME> to “ON”.
[The time is automatically adjusted one hour forward in
the summer.
End date/time setting.
• Press the [MENU] button.
[The monitor screen returns to the main menu screen
and the time count starts from 00 second.
• Press the [MENU] button again to restore the normal screen.

4-3 Date and Time Setting
Summer Time Compensation
• When setting the time, make sure the <SUMMER TIME> item is set to
“OFF”.
When this unit is shipped, this item is set to
“OFF”.
Standard time
Set the clock to the actual time.
When daylight savings start, set the <SUMMER TIME>
item to “ON”.
• The time advances one hour on the display.
During daylight savings time
Set the time with a one-hour delay.
After setting the time, set the <SUMMER TIME> item to
“ON”.
• The set time advances one hour.
At the end of the daylight savings time season, set the
<SUMMER TIME> item to
“OFF”.
• The standard time instead of <SUMMER TIME> is
displayed.
4-4 Hour Meter Display
Drum rotation time is displayed on the monitor
’s screen and the VCR's display in the form of an hour meter. Use this data to
schedule maintenance.
Operation
Turn on the VCR and monitor.
Press the [MENU] button to display the main menu.
Press the [SHIFT 7] button to set the cursor on the
<HOUR METER> on the main menu.
Press the [SET +/
–] button to show the hour meter (drum
rotating time) on the monitor.
Press the [MENU] button twice to restore the normal
screen.

Notes:
• If the power plug has been disconnected from an AC outlet for a long time, make sure the set time is correct before
using the unit. (Clock time may be affected by environmental factors.)
• When the built-in backup battery capacity is low, the error indication E-10 appears on the display. Contact your local
JVC dealer to replace the built-in battery.
Time setting for 29 seconds or less
When the seconds value is 29 or less, you can reset it to 00 by
pressing the [CNT RESET] button while pressing the [RESET/
CANCEL] button.
• For 30 or more, the seconds value is reset to 00 and the
minutes value is increased by one.
